你知道CSS中长度单位pt、px、dpi的意思吗?
在印刷世界里,“point”是一个精确而固定的单位,它代表着1/72英寸的长度,这个长度是可以通过尺子来实际测量的。当我们进入网页设计和CSS领域时,“point”(pt)的含义就发生了微妙的变化。
在CSS中,当我们设定字体为9pt时,这并非表示真实的物理长度。浏览器会按照CSS的规范来解释这个尺寸。这是一个常见的误解,因为在显示屏幕上,我们看到的一切都是通过像素来呈现的。像素是构成图像的最小单位,每个像素只能展示一种颜色。以pt为单位的长度需要转换为以像素为单位的长度才能被屏幕正确显示。这个转换的关键就在于dpi(或PPI,即每英寸像素数)。
不论你使用的是哪种操作系统,Firefox浏览器的默认dpi值通常为96。这意味着,在屏幕上,9pt的字体实际上会被转换为12像素的高度。虽然“dpi”中的“I”和“pt”等于1/72英寸中的“inch”都表示单位换算,但它们并不代表真实的物理长度。这两个单位在进行换算时是等价的,可以相互转换。
那么,如何计算真实的物理长度呢?你需要一把尺子,测量你的显示器的可见宽度(假设为11.2992英寸),然后除以你的显示器的横向分辨率(假设为1024像素)。这样你就可以得到每个像素的物理长度。
现在我们可以解答一个问题:网页上9pt的字体究竟占用了多少空间?通过一系列的计算和换算,我们可以得到答案约为0.33厘米(约合每像素)。这有助于我们更准确地理解网页设计和排版中的尺寸设置。感兴趣的朋友们可以自己尝试一下这个计算过程,深入理解网页设计中的单位换算和物理长度的关系。
网站模板
- 你知道CSS中长度单位pt、px、dpi的意思吗?
- Win10系统自带放大镜工具的路径在哪
- APP今日免费-这样的酷跑游戏简直太虐心
- 浏览器崩溃提示此网页包含重定向循环怎么办?
- Ai怎么绘制饮水机图标-
- Win10应用商店及自带应用出现闪退的最新解决方法
- 电脑打字的时候鼠标光标总是乱跑该怎解决-
- Win8判断电脑所用系统是32位还是64位的方法
- W3C教程(9)-W3C XPath 活动
- 惠普台式电脑开机后出现1999错误怎么办?电脑开
- Win8系统IE浏览器地址栏有很大变化如何使用呢
- 教你一招 巧用U盘破除管理员密码
- 删除文件或文件夹被拒需要administrators提供权限怎
- msfeedssync.exe的介绍以及关闭的方法
- USB复古打字机键盘设计 与平板完全融合!
- 笔记本电脑常见问题解答